## Environments: Coinharrow conversion service

Three environments: dev, staging, prod. Rounding errors surfaced in staging only — it ran banker's rounding while prod used half-up, so converted totals diverged by a cent on some pairs. All environments now pin the same rounding mode and precision. Do not promote a build unless staging and prod configs match. The canonical per-environment settings are listed below.

settings of kageg-yawig:
[casix]
host = casix.tolvaqlabs.corp
user = casix_svc
database = casix_prod

- [ ] **Step 7: Breaker override escrow.** After sealing the signing keys for the Tallgrove upstream API circuit breaker, confirm the support team can force the breaker open during a full outage. The override bundle lives in the sealed escrow drawer and is useless without its unlock phrase. Two ceremony witnesses must initial this step before proceeding. The escrow bundle is decrypted with the recovery passphrase that follows.

vault phrase of kahip-kahop = holath-quenmir

The Vantrell ingest workers are leaking file descriptors at roughly 40 per hour per process, traced to an unclosed socket in the retry path introduced in release 4.18. At current growth, workers will hit the descriptor ceiling within six days, causing hard connection failures rather than graceful degradation. We recommend holding the 4.19 cut until the patch from Team Ridgeline lands and soak-tests cleanly. The ongoing hunt, heap captures, and candidate fix are tracked on the internal page.

operations page: https://jira.qorvelsys.internal/browse/pages/browse/pages